
Today information on an upcoming headset by Microsoft and HP, with support for SteamVR was found on Twitter. The most interesting part? It’s said to be built in collaboration with Valve.
Microsoft currently has a VR platform called Windows Mixed Reality with multiple available headsets. It seems the company and its partners are expanding on that relationship with a new headset from HP. Other headsets could be following suit. The store page for this HP headset is already online, with a ”Coming Soon” placeholder and a screenshot of the front of the device.
